REAR-DEFROST?

The rear defroster on my car will shut off before the back window is defrosted. Has anyone had this problem , if so what is the fix for it?

Check the connection in the hatch on the upper left side next to the strut. It may be loose, its not a very well connected piece. It fixed mine...

How long does it stay on before it kicks off? By design, I think they "time out" at 15 mins.
